The Wilder Side of Life (US, 60s-70s): Velvet Underground, MC5, Iggy Pop

This programme is held in Hungarian.

While in late-1960s California hippie culture and the psychedelic rock that sprang from it were triumphant, on the East Coast of the United States some representatives of the new generation were much more fascinated by the darker, wilder side of life. In their songs they did not sing about sunshine, dreams, peace, longing for love and grass-LSD trips, but about death, hard drugs (heroin), transvestites, bisexuality, sadomasochism. Their music was characterized by an oppressive atmosphere, listlessness, dissonance and noise. The early shadows of New York (Velvet Underground) and Detroit (MC5, Stooges) were precursors of the later punk revolution. They will be the subject of the next lecture of the Rock and Roll Free University with a rock-music guided tour by Jávorszky Béla Szilárd.

A rock-history lecture series from the blues through Elvis to the seventies. At the MZH Multimedia Library and Club a regular monthly program started in 2022 under the title Rock and Roll Free University. The Rock and Roll Free University presents the most important processes and performers of international pop history. It holds that rock and roll, somewhat simplistically, is the result of a peculiar cultural-historical marriage: when the musical tradition of the black slaves brought from Africa (blues) and the musical tradition of the white settlers who emigrated from Europe (country) met and continuously mixed with each other on a third continent, America. Moreover, all this took place in a society radically transformed by technological development and the related industrialization and urbanization. In the ninth season of this series (spring 2026) we will scrutinize the social, cultural and musical events taking place in the United States at the turn of the 1960s and 1970s.
